Why it's worth checking out

Eumundi Square, in the charming hinterland town of Eumundi on the Sunshine Coast, is the home of the renowned Eumundi Markets — one of the largest and most famous art, craft and produce markets in the country. Held under the shade of the town's heritage fig trees, the markets bring the historic main street to life with hundreds of stalls.

The appeal is that vibrant, only-in-Eumundi experience: artisan crafts, local produce, food, fashion and live music, all in a delightful village setting that's become a beloved Sunshine Coast institution and a must-do day trip from the coast. Beyond market days, the square and the charming town are well worth a wander in their own right.

With a 4.6 rating from more than 1,500 reviews, it's a much-loved destination. The famous markets run on set days — typically a couple of times a week — so it's essential to check the current market days and times before you go, and arriving early helps beat the crowds and the heat, leaving time to explore the stalls and the lovely town around them.
